Day 4 , went out of Forestville, east on Tq3 about a mile then all local orange trails . Definitely keeping sleds cool was a challenge after it being 50° ish yesterday and below freezing today . Awesome day on the trails for sure 👌!
Forecast for the weekend looks promising, 6+ inches hopefully.. but we're outta here for now on the way back to Vermont . Cheers
-
Today had a little of a delay start leaving Km31 , had a stud vs aluminum heat exchanger issue with one of the team members .. all good with some fancy epoxy goop .
Did a few work-arounds to skip the 93 on the way to the Escoumins club house, we popped out by De l'Or-Piste on the Pelchat trail . Smooth sailing all the way . Conditions from mashed potatoes to skating rink .
Ran some local trails and 330/ TQ3 into Forestville for the night.
Coverage starting to disappear here n there... but 3 days near 50°f will do that

Drove up from Vt to Forestville Sunday and met up with Roadrunner our friends from Maine .
Left this morning on rock hard local trails towards Chenail du Nord After a quick stop we're off to the Pipmuacan Reservoir. Dropped on down to pourvoirie Itouk to say hi to Luc the place was rocking on a sunny Monday afternoon ! Next stop La Chapelle then off to Km31 for the night . 215 miles for the day
Was awesome this morning to see and chat with Trailblazer in Forestville and meeting Linda sled girl here at the 31 !
